Myanmar police launch random arrests against Rohingya

7 November 2017

Arakan News Agency

Arakan news agency reported that the Myanmar police began random arrests in several villages of the state of Arakan against Rohingya Muslims from public roads.
The correspondent added that 38 Rohingyas were arrested while they were on the road, practicing their daily life from Fainr village and beating them with  sticks and belts, while there are also reports of extortion of money from detained Rohingyas for large amount of money in possession.
He added that other people were also taken to the police station later in various locations and then subjected to severe beatings and torture, while retaining of a mobile phone from one person.
